At its core, a peptide is formed by linking amino acids together. The specific linkage is known as a peptide bond, which is an amide-type covalent chemical bond. This bond forms between the alpha-carbon of the carboxyl group of one amino acid and the alpha-carbon of the amino group of another. The formation of this bond results in the release of a water molecule, a process known as dehydration synthesis. The repeating unit formed by this linkage, including the carbonyl carbon and the amide nitrogen, is often referred to as the "peptide group" or "peptide residue" within a larger peptide chain. Peptides are increasingly recognized as attractive targets for drug discovery. Compared to traditional small molecules, peptides often exhibit enhanced selectivity and binding affinity to their biological targets.
